School Overview
Hancock Middle-High School, located in Hancock, Michigan, serves as a central educational hub for the local community, operating under the Hancock Public Schools district. The institution provides a combined secondary education experience, typically serving students from middle school through high school. By housing both levels on one campus, the school aims to create a cohesive academic environment that fosters a smooth transition for students as they progress through their formative years. The school is known for being deeply integrated into the unique cultural and geographic landscape of the Keweenaw Peninsula.
Academically and extracurricularly, the school emphasizes a well-rounded curriculum designed to prepare students for post-secondary success, whether that involves college, vocational training, or the workforce. The school prides itself on a supportive faculty and a range of opportunities that often include athletic programs, arts, and extracurricular clubs, reflecting the values of a small, tight-knit community.
